How they compare
Bangladesh currently reports 66.24 units per square kilometre against 4.12 units per square kilometre in East Asia & Pacific (excluding high income), a difference of 62.12 units per square kilometre.
That makes Bangladesh's figure about 16.1 times East Asia & Pacific (excluding high income)'s.
Across all 63 years both countries report, Bangladesh has been ahead every year.

Head to head by decade
| Decade | Bangladesh | East Asia & Pacific (excluding high income) |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 21.29 units per square kilometre | 2.87 units per square kilometre | 18.43 units per square kilometre | Bangladesh |
| 1970s | 29.13 units per square kilometre | 3.89 units per square kilometre | 25.25 units per square kilometre | Bangladesh |
| 1980s | 37.35 units per square kilometre | 5.25 units per square kilometre | 32.1 units per square kilometre | Bangladesh |
| 1990s | 50.3 units per square kilometre | 4.79 units per square kilometre | 45.51 units per square kilometre | Bangladesh |
| 2000s | 59 units per square kilometre | 5.21 units per square kilometre | 53.78 units per square kilometre | Bangladesh |
| 2010s | 63.09 units per square kilometre | 4.28 units per square kilometre | 58.82 units per square kilometre | Bangladesh |
| 2020s | 66.97 units per square kilometre | 4.06 units per square kilometre | 62.91 units per square kilometre | Bangladesh |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Population ages 15-19, female divided by Land area (sq. km),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
